Responsibilities:
- Comply with AGAT Policies, Quality Procedures, and ISO standards applicable to the Quality Assurance position
- Lead proper implementation and oversight of the Quality Management System (QMS) by:
- Creating and communicating reports on QA/QC metrics to the management team
- Providing training to staff
- Performing internal audits
- Participating in external assessments / audits with accreditation / registration bodies /clients
- Perform scheduled verifications that all depts. perform checks of balances, working weights and thermometers, pipets, etc.
- Participating in professional development and training
- Provide assistance and support for the following:
- Investigation of client complaints and reporting of responses
- Investigation of Internal Corrective Actions and ensure the remedy is effective
- Review and updating of the measurement uncertainty data collected for technical methods
- Writing, revision and control management of procedures and associated documents
- Assist in the management of the external calibration program and laboratory proficiency testing activities
- Implementing corporate standardized and regional policies and procedures
- Development and validation of local technical methods
- Be a strong proponent for risk-based thinking and improvement initiatives
- Provide technical and advisory support on matters related to the QMS
- Report any deviation(s) from documented procedures to the General Manager, Quality
- Act in a safe and professional manner and wear appropriate attire including the required personal protective equipment (PPE)
- Report any unsafe condition(s) observed during the dispensation of their duties to the General Manager, Quality
